Careers get in the way of their relationship and then Claire and Ryan realize what is more important in life
31 December 2021
There is some real life reality in this film where personal careers and goals temporarily take priority over Ryan (Kyle Selig) and Claire's (Laura Osnes) own relationship. The Christmas period is that magical time when forgiveness is on everyone's mind and reconciliation between estranged family and friends occurs more often than anytime of the year.

The supporting cast was just that, very supportive in their respective roles and to have the lead singer of Train, Pat Monahan, play Jackson, an administration assistant to Claire was a Christmas gift for all of us.

The only knock against this made for TV film was the producers and film editor decided to insert that irritating musical "bing bong Christmas tingle" interlude through most of the films conversation and I for one just get tired of hearing that cheesy bing bong twinkle background sound throughout. Never the less, I would recommend the film to both romantics and Christmas film lovers. I give it a respectable 6 out of 10 IMDb rating.
